The tile roof mounting system has become the unsung hero of renewable energy installations, especially as Mediterranean-style architecture makes a comeback in suburban America. Unlike standard asphalt shingles, clay or concrete tiles require mounting solutions that preserve roof integrity while handling that precious solar cargo.

A 2024 Arizona project saw 23% energy gains using ventilated mounts that reduced surface temperatures by 18°F. The secret sauce? Thermal break technology that prevents heat transfer to roof tiles. Homeowners reported lower AC bills before even factoring in solar production!
The industry's buzzing about BIPV (Building-Integrated Photovoltaics) that transforms tiles themselves into solar collectors. Imagine your roof shedding its solar panel "hat" to become one seamless power-generating surface. Early adopters in California are already seeing 40% faster installation times with these hybrid systems.
Florida's 2024 hurricane season put mounting systems through trial by tempest. The winners? Systems using aerodynamic rail designs that reduced wind uplift by 62% compared to traditional models.
